Hi,
I've got a quick question. I'm not very good with machinery, so here goes! I want to drop the hitch on a Zetor 6441. The tractor is on and I'm pushing the lever in the cab forward to open the hitch, so that it drops down. Basically, I just want to change the hitch around and use the drawbar.

The only problem is that the lever won't move forward. Does it need much pressure, I don't want to break it! Do I need to press something else?

Thanks!
 
i have never tried a 6441 hitch but on our massey the hydraulic arms must be lifted all the way then pull the handleand whilst holding the handle let the arms down . hope this helps you;)
